This is a simple black-and-white sketch of a young man facing forward. His hair is neatly combed, and he wears a collared shirt with a bow tie. The lines are soft, and the face looks calm but a little serious. The signature in the corner says "F. Cormon, 1905," so this was drawn over a century ago.
